Marcus Collins is a marketing professor at the University of Michigan, recognized for his insights into consumer behavior and brand strategy. He often discusses the impact of technological advancements on marketing practices and has commented on the challenges facing companies like Apple in the rapidly evolving tech landscape. His expertise includes analyzing the intersection of innovation and consumer expectations, particularly in the context of historical figures like Steve Jobs.
